Nuclear Charge Radii from Atomic K X Rays

Abstract

Isotope shifts of K x-ray transitions have been measured in several isotopes of Gd, Dy, Er, and Hf. The results of these observations, together with results of previously communicated measurements on Sn, Nd, Sm, W, Hg, Pb, and U, have been analyzed in terms of even nuclear charge moments. The dominant moment δr2 is listed for 26 isotope pairs. A comparison of the x-ray shifts with the optical isotope shifts furnishes in several cases the optical specific mass shifts. The difficulties of comparison with muonic x-ray isotope shifts are discussed.
